Globie does not provide a truly unlimited data eSIM plan for Nigeria. The plans listed as “Unlimited” actually contain only 1GB of high‑speed data per day; once that daily limit is reached the speed is reduced to 512 kbps. Therefore the data allowance is capped and not unlimited.
If you need more data, Globie offers fixed‑data plans that may be more cost effective. For example, a 20GB plan for 30 days costs $79.99 USD, while a 10GB plan for the same duration is $44.49 USD. These alternatives give you a larger total data allowance without the speed throttling that applies after the “Unlimited” plan’s daily cap.
Globie does not provide eSIM plans for Nigeria that include a phone number or SMS capability. All of Globie’s offerings for Nigeria are data‑only plans, meaning travelers can use the data connection for web browsing, apps, and VoIP services such as WhatsApp, Telegram or iMessage but cannot place or receive traditional SMS or voice calls on the local network.
Globie offers 9 single‑country data plans and 12 multi‑country plans that include Nigeria, for a total of 21 distinct options. Prices range from $6.99 to $202.49 while data allocations vary between 1 GB and 20 GB. Some plans are fixed‑data packages that provide a set amount of data for the validity period, whereas other plans employ a daily data cap, limiting the amount of data that can be used each day.
